Azureus v2.3.0.2 Released - May 25, 2005

Azureus is a Java based BitTorrent client that offers multiple torrent downloads, queuing/priority systems (on torrents and files), start/stop seeding options and instant access to numerous pieces of information about your torrents. It also features an embedded tracker that is easily set up and ready to use.

What’s New:

New Features:

    [li]UI | Console UI now has update check, alerting and DHT stats[/li][li]UI | SWT make torrent wizard remembers value for “add other hashes”[/li][li]UI | Console UI logging config[/li][li]Plug | Added progress indicator and torrent stats to tracker web templates[/li][li]Plug | Availability column added to webui + some alignment changes[/li][li]Plug | XML/http interface access to individual torrent file stats added[/list][/li]
    Changes:
      [li]Core | CPU usage reductions when connected to many idle peers[/li][li]Core | Disable console view logging by default[/li][li]Core | Memory usage reductions and optimizations[/li][li]Core | Improved long-term connection-attempt management[/li][li]Core | DHT bootstrap in absence of version-check server improved[/li][li]Core | DHT IP filter reports reduced[/li][li]Core | Disk manager read/write threads now started on demand[/li][li]UI | Default for “add other hashes” in make torrent wizard and sharing config changed to false[/li][li]UI | Retention of log history removed as taking up to 1MB mem[/li][li]UI | Added missing spaces back into SWT dock item’s tooltip[/li][li]UI | Restore version number on status bar and add protocol rate to the stats view[/li][li]Plug | JPC plugin refactoring to help reduce cache server load[/list][/li]
      Corrected bugs:
        [li]Core | Fix compatibility with JRE 1.4 series under Win32 due to NIO bug[/li][li]Core | Ignore peers with these data ports config option didn’t work the DHT and PEX obtained peers[/li][li]Core | DHT IP derivation from contacts fixed[/li][/list]
